Dividend yield

Trailing dividends per share as a percentage of the share price — the cash income a shareholder receives at today's price. Shown as not-applicable for a structural non-payer, distinct from the '—' shown when dividend data is incomplete.

Formula

TTM dividends per share ÷ price × 100
